Overview

The STM32WL3RK8V6 is a highly integrated sub-GHz wireless System-on-Chip (SoC) combining an Arm Cortex-M0+ core running at 64 MHz with a multi-protocol radio. It supports a wide range of modulations including 2(G)FSK, 4(G)FSK, OOK, ASK, and D-BPSK across the 413-479 MHz and 826-958 MHz bands. This device is optimized for ultra-low power consumption, featuring a high-efficiency SMPS and power modes as low as 0.377 uA in standby.

Why Choose This Part

This SoC eliminates the need for an external RF transceiver, reducing BOM cost and PCB footprint in a 32-VFQFN package. It provides a high output power of 20 dBm and a sensitivity of -132 dBm, ensuring robust links over long distances. The integrated AES-128 hardware accelerator and secure bootloader provide essential security for IoT endpoints.

Applications

Smart Utility Metering
Ideal for battery-powered water, gas, and heat meters requiring long-range communication via WM-Bus or proprietary protocols.
Industrial Sensor Networks
Used in long-range industrial monitoring for collecting data from remote sensors in environments where cabling is impractical.
Home and Building Automation
Enables wireless connectivity for KNX, Zigbee, and smart lighting controls within the sub-GHz spectrum for better wall penetration.
Asset Tracking
Supports LPWAN protocols like Sigfox for wide-area tracking of assets with minimal battery maintenance.

Getting Started

Developers can start with the STM32CubeWL software package, which includes the hardware abstraction layer (HAL) and radio stacks. Hardware evaluation is typically performed using the NUCLEO-WL33CC development board. Projects are managed through STM32CubeIDE, which provides integrated tools for configuration, code generation, and power consumption analysis.
